Its biggest project failures and what we can learn from them. Information technology systems are not without flaws, often leading to. Project management software software development government it 1 2 3 4 page 1 next. The biggest software failures in recent history including ransomware attacks. Mar 15, 2016 the nhss huge npfit project, intended to serve 40,000 gps and 300 plus hospitals, was claimed to be the worlds largest civil it project. Their main goal is platform adoption and usage which. The report revealed that these software failures affected 3. Pdf identifying the reasons for software project failure. The history of software development is a tremendous success. The software process models play a very important role in software development, so it forms the core of the software product. This it system, a multimillion dollar project, was the first of its kind. Case studies analyzed include the wellknown confirm travel industry reservation program, foxmeyers delta, the irss tax system modernization, the denver international airports baggage. This report looks at why software projects fail and how failing can be avoided.
Key phases of software development projects segue technologies. Sep 26, 2016 the project management landscape is changing. In software development failures, kweku ewusimensah offers an empirically grounded study that suggests why these failures happen and how they can be avoided. So the big question is why does a software project fail, if at all. Software project failures are no fun for anyone involved. Mandated reflection, he says, could prompt much greater transparency between purchasers and suppliers and also help lift competencies across the industry. Why software projects fail, and the traps you can avoid that. Software fixes were announced as remedies for all of them. Needless to say, computers and the software that makes them useful, have an even larger impact on our lives than olsen could have expected, and. Top 15 worst computer software blunders intertech blog. A collection of wellknown software failures software systems are pervasive in all aspects of society. With an increased emphasis on efficiency, reporting, and a newfound stress on the information technology industry, being a project manager today is radically different than being a project manager in 2005.
Following are 20 famous software disasters in chronological order. This makes it one of the major causes of project failure. I will start with a study of economic cost of software bugs. Possible failures are poor user input, stakeholder conflicts, vague requirements, poor cost and cost and schedule estimation, skills that do not match the job, hidden costs of going lean and mean, failure plan, communication breakdowns, poor architecture, late. List of failed and overbudget custom software projects wikipedia. According to new research, success in 68 percent of technology projects is improbable. Poor requirements analysis causes many of these failures, meaning projects. Or that every day, major organizations report that their data was exploited. However, most of the literature that discusses project failure tends to be rather general.
Jul, 2015 knowing the basics of software development can greatly improve the project outcome. The biggest software failures in recent history computerworld. Weak requirements definitions leads to inadequate planning. A major reason that software development projects fail is due to poor project management. Because software, unlike a major civil engineering construction project, is often easy and cheap to change after it has been constructed, a. Jun 10, 2012 survey data is a useful tool for heads of project management offices pmos to gain a broad perspective on the major causes of it project failures and to assist in the challenge of identifying, building, and developing the skills and staff required for highly effective project and program leadership. Jul 30, 20 key phases of software development projects written by irma azarian on july 30, 20 the software development life cycle sdlc can be defined differently by any organization, but it usually consists of the following activities that work together to mature a concept into a software product. Ford did extensive market research before it released the edsel.
Agile projects come with a set of challenges and problems that are different from those faced by projects following a traditional methodology. In recent years, tech failures such as the uk governments welfare reform project universal credit have made it into international news. Glitches in software development and testing have led delivery of. In fact, its illfated intended central core, a nationwide electronic health record ehr facility, dramatically illustrates one of the most serious causes of large it project failures. Why it projects continue to fail at an alarming rate.
G00231952 a recent gartner user survey shows that, while large it projects are more likely to fail than small projects, around half of all project failures, irrespective of project size, were put down to functionality issues and substantial delays. They serve to easily manage tasks like time tracking, cost tracking, cost estimations and more. These top 15 worst computer software blunders led to embarrassment, massive financial losses, and even death. Jul 19, 2017 most software projects fail completely or partial because they dont meet all their requirements. A literature search shows that most software development projects are considered as partial failures due to technical and nontechnical factors. An information system failure can cause financial loss, commercial embarrassment, loss of customers and revenue streams, sanctions and the loss of staff morale or stakeholder allegiance in an. Top 5 project failure reasons, or why my project fails. This emphasises the advantages of shorter timescales and a phased approach to building systems, so that change has less chance to affect development. This came at a very bad time as the uks debt management office dmo. We all know software bugs can be annoying, but faulty software can also be expensive, embarrassing, destructive and deadly. The odds of a large project finishing on time are close to zero. When ceos help their cios prepare for board roles it may seem counterintuitive for ceos to encourage and even coach their cios and senior business leaders to serve on outside boards, but doing so can deliver real business benefits. Ballooning costs, feature creep, vendor lockin and just plain bad technology have contributed to some of its most spectacular project failures.
Real life examples of software development failures tricentis. The following entry is a record in the catalogue of catastrophe a list of failed or troubled projects from around the world. Today, special tools are used to get the full and uptodate picture of the project progress. This paper examines how organizations can recognize the signs of project failure and how they can save failing projects. Requirements often cause projects to fail when sponsors write specification documents in a vacuum, leaving the development team out of the process. An information system project according to ewusimensah 1997 is any information technology project intended to meet the information processing need of an organization. Top 7 factors that contribute towards project failure. Most software projects fail completely or partial failures because a small number of projects meet all their requirements.
Knowing the basics of software development can greatly improve the project outcome. The ariane 5 rocket flight 501 was part of the ariane project, a western european project signed in 1973 that aimed to transport a couple of threeton satellites into orbit with each launch and intended to give europe a position of power in the commercial space. The biggest software failures in recent years dzone agile. First, software projects more than several weeks in length are notoriously difficult to scope. Software development projects often run late or fail altogether. Because every project and its resources are finite, project managers must work with and around their limits. Project failure common reasons why it project fail reqtest. The system of systems that was to provide ehrs was initially designed by a large central team and intended as a complete bigbang replacement for the many and varied existing ehr systems. Gartner survey shows why projects fail thisiswhatgoodlookslike.
A botched migration to a new software platform in april at tsb bank in the united kingdom caused major disruptions for weeks, angered the banks 5 million customers, and eventually led to the. Apr 25, 2016 the fastest way to succeed is to double your failure rate. In doing so, it describes seven reasons that the authors have identified as most often causing. The important points ive learned from this article are about the possible causes of failing the projects. Managing the software development process has become one of the major areas for research especially in todays information driven economy. What are the top 10 causes of project management failures. It allows us to complete most of our daily tasks, and most jobs require software and a computer. Biggest uk government project failures its often bewildering when a government project screws up spectacularly. To give you an idea of possible consequences that may result from software failure, in this article, i will be presenting cases of software failure and its effects. Problems resulted from either an incorrect understanding or implementation of practices and the agile culture, or inadequate tooling. It categorizes these reasons into one of three factorbased categoriespeople, processes, and communicationsand outlines a fivephase process for assessing failing projects, noting this processs primary concepts, variables, and activities. The 6 project constraints and how to manage them workfront.
Development downtime is one of the primary contributors to challenged or failed projects. According to many studies, failure rate of software projects is between 50% 80%. Taking after are 6 famous software disasters in as beneath. The long, dismal history of software project failure coding horror. Dec 05, 2011 software projects that are waterfallish in nature have the problems you mention for relatively wellunderstood, but difficult to avoid reasons.
Managing a project is really about managing the schedule, but a schedule is really a collection of resources that are being managed on a schedule. List of failed and overbudget custom software projects. It has been suggested that there is more than one reason for a software development project to fail. Other devrel roles are focused on product management and developer experience. None of the failures mentioned in the two cases above were a failure of agile development. What are the major causes of information systems failures. Additionally, you should use a project management system which enables smooth communication within your. Adding manpower to a late software project makes it later.
Because software, unlike a major civil engineering construction project, is often easy and cheap to change after it has been constructed, a piece of custom software that fails to deliver on its objectives may sometimes be modified over time in such a way that it later succeeds andor business processes or enduser mindsets may change to accommodate the software. An empirically based study of why software development failures happen, and the lessons we can learn. However, there are some highprofile failures, and anyone practicing or looking to implement agile should learn from these examples. Major causes of software project failures by lorin j. Jun 04, 2019 finding the right project management software is one of the easiest steps to take so that youre on right track the successful project track. It is not often you are given such a front seat view on disasters. While this quote is by no means dogma, nor a desirable way to obtain success, a plethora of companies have had to experience, and learn from, great failures. As the success of digital transformation projects become ever more central to competing in many industries, it leaders need to bridge the gap between successful project deployments and the technologyenabled future. May, l 1998 in major causes of software failure stated that only onesixth 16. From electronic voting to online shopping, a significant part of our daily life is mediated by software. Merchandise was stuck in the companys depots and warehouses and was not getting through to many of its stores. Needless to say, computers and the software that makes them useful, have an even larger impact on our lives than olsen could have expected, and when things go wrong, they really go wrong. In doing so, it describes seven reasons that the authors have identified as most often causing project failure.
Also important is retaining the skills already available within an organisation and developing existing and new talent through. Since my first attempt to participate in it and software development projects, i learned a variety of project failure reasons that made my projects stop because of the lack of finances, no requirements met, poor quality, no collaboration, no focus on teamwork, etc. As a matter of fact, programming bugs can irritate, however, the defective programming can likewise be costly, humiliating, ruinous and savage. A research study done by software testing company tricentis revealed that in the year 2017 software failure affected 3. Why projects fail the six key project failure reasons. Finding the right project management software is one of the easiest steps to take so that youre on right track the successful project track. Because software, unlike a major civil engineering construction project. Major causes of information systems failure information. Its biggest project failures and what we can learn. Each year, organizations around the world expend much of their resources in implementing projects that ultimately fail for reasons complex and oftentimes, for reasons simple. With the changes in the industry, its easy to lose track of how often projects fail, what.
Software project failure is often devastating to an organization. Dec 05, 2018 the software fail watch is a sobering reminder of the scope of impact that software and therefore software development and testing has on our day to day lives. The software fail watch is a sobering reminder of the scope of impact that software and therefore software development and testing has on our day to day lives. One of the biggest pm responsibilities is managing project constraints, which also happen to overlap with your major knowledge areas, in order to ensure that your project gets completed on time, on budget, and with the appropriate allocated resources. This essay is a compilation of failure causes of software development projects. A literature search shows that most software development projects are considered as partial failures due to. These are the project scope, risks and key assumptions. Jul 15, 20 these top 15 worst computer software blunders led to embarrassment, massive financial losses, and even death. In 2016, as part of the usas renewed focus on border security, the us customs and border protection cbp was charged with. The long, dismal history of software project failure. From outsized expectations to fundamental feature changes, software development projects get derailed or declared failures thanks to a variety of project management and technical factors. The lack of foresight or stakeholders confidence can be a huge reason for the failure in seeing the bigger picture in developing the software. When you consider the amount of planning done by experts and implementation by skilled workers, you would think that disasters would be rarer than they are.
The biggest software failures in recent history including ransomware attacks, it outages and data leakages that have affected some of the biggest companies and millions of customers around the world. Failure is an unavoidable part of any project process. The framework is heavily promoted as a solution for software development woes. The enormous cost of it project failure intheblack. Each phase of software development life cycle, sdlc, is equally important. Reasons why software projects fail outsource2india.
You increase the chances of having one of the cause of project management failures if you mismanage your resource schedule. Major factors that lead to software project failure are application bug. When the pending success or failure of a software project puts an individuals career on the line, its likely that any related business decisions will be impacted. The nhss huge npfit project, intended to serve 40,000 gps and 300 plus hospitals, was claimed to be the worlds largest civil it project. These include software engineering failures of all sortssecurity, usability, performance, and so on. So if thats the case and your objective is to serve customers, proficiency during the development phase is key. Human resources internal communications it developer. This can be one of the major reasons for the failure of a software project. Even t he name edsel is synonymous with marketing failure. A survey conducted by spike cavell shows that 57% of projects failed due to poor communication. According to many studies, failure rate of software projects ranges between 50% 80%.
As the examples of recent software failures below reveal, a major. Key findings runaway budget costs are behind onequarter. Failed or abandoned software development projects cost the u. However uncontrolled changes play havoc with a system under development and have caused many project failures. Unfortunately, it is hard learn something out of this book. The fastest way to succeed is to double your failure rate. To save your project from failure, you need to establish a clear communication channel. Lessons of the most memorable project failures teach us to receive feedback, maintain active communication with employees and business partners, and collect important data on business processes. Causes of softwareinformation technology project failures in.
Pingback by the top four reasons why software projects fail deep stuff campbell custom software inc on apr. This need continues throughout development process. Given the amount of waste in the public service, australian computer society vicepresident professor paul bailes is keen for government to step up, with more forensic analysis of its project failures. There are a variety of causes for software failures but the most common. Here are a couple of reasons it projects continue to fail at an alarming rate and strategies to address them. Some team leads for the it projects are under the wrong impression that development tasks are major for the success of projects. If a task fails, there are ways to reallocate resources and get. Five top reasons software development projects fail. Finding and scrutinizing reasons for failure is a crucial part of the project management cycle. Even after utilizing the collective software development experience of hundreds of software companies and software experts over the years, across the globe, a large chunk of software projects still fail big time. Bill gates cites the edsel flop as his favorite case study. Looking at these famous flops through the lens of a project manager, we can learn how to spot issues before they have a chance to derail our plans, so we can avoid project failure.
Its biggest project failures and what we can learn from. There are three potential causes of project failure that are the most important of all and, if dealt with fully and completely, can help to avoid project failure. Real life examples of software development failures. Jan 26, 2018 the report revealed that these software failures affected 3. Oct 23, 2018 is a cloudbased project management software that gives project managers and their teams everything they need to plan, monitor and report on their project. The biggest software failures in recent history including ransomware attacks, it outages and data leakages that have affected some of the biggest companies and millions of customers around the. Try and get awardwinning pm tracking and reporting tools that can spot problems and present solutions. Jun, 2011 there are three potential causes of project failure that are the most important of all and, if dealt with fully and completely, can help to avoid project failure. What are the most common causes of software project failure. One important step in estimating the time required for a project is to try to identify all of the functional requirements of the new system.